Burullus Power Project 4800 MW

Region: Egypt Status: Completed

PLANT DESCRIPTION

Eight Siemens combustion turbine generators using gas as fuel, complemented by associated balance of plant systems. It also incorporates eight NEM Benson-type heat recovery steam generators, four Siemens steam turbine generators, four water-cooled condensers, and four cooling towers, each with their respective balance of plant systems. The facility utilizes seawater as its raw water source and primarily operates on fuel gas, with two combustion turbine generators capable of using light fuel oil if necessary. Power generated undergoes step-up through main transformers and is then transmitted to the 500 kV grid through gas-insulated switchgear. The plant encompasses various systems, including power block components, cooling towers, balance of plant elements, a 500 kV GIS, and a water treatment plant.

 
 

Project Details

Owner

Middle Delta Electricity Production Company

Client

Orascom Construction (Partner to Siemens AG in the EPC Consortium)

Location

Egypt, Kafr El Sheikh

Date of Award

August 2015

Scope

PGESCO scope is Full EPCM services for the power plant including but not limited the power train, all supporting Balance of Plant and auxiliaries, the scope covers engineering, procurement, project and construction management.
